Index: docs/clang-tidy/index.rst
===================================================================
--- docs/clang-tidy/index.rst
+++ docs/clang-tidy/index.rst
@@ -650,7 +650,8 @@
An additional check enabled by ``check_clang_tidy.py`` ensures that
if `CHECK-MESSAGES:` is used in a file then every warning or error
-must have an associated CHECK in that file.
+must have an associated CHECK in that file. Or, you can use ``CHECK-NOTES:``
+instead, if you want to **also** ensure that all the notes are checked.
